SB NO. 1 ENROLLED 1 §1963. Jimmy D. Long, Sr. Louisiana School of for Math, Science, and the Arts; 2 creation; location; governance; relationship with educational boards 3 and state superintendent 4 A.(1) There is hereby created the Jimmy D. Long, Sr. Louisiana School of 5 for Math, Science, and the Arts which shall be a residential institution located on the 6 campus of Northwestern State University of Louisiana at Natchitoches. The school 7 shall open and formally begin operation with the fall semester of 1983. The school 8 shall be funded by the state from monies appropriated therefor; and, full-time 9 students at the school shall attend without payment of tuition. 10 (2) The official name of the school shall be the "Jimmy D. Long, Sr. 11 Louisiana School for Math, Science, and the Arts"; however, the school may 12 continue to use "Louisiana School of Math, Science, and the Arts" for all 13 practical purposes as determined by the board. 14 * * * 15 §1964. Legislative intent 13 It is the intent of the legislature to establish a college-based residential school 14 for certain high school students with the express purpose of providing a more 15 challenging educational experience and a more enriched creative environment for the 16 children of this state who have a demonstrated talent for and interest in pursuing the 17 creative and performing arts and of developing such children to their full potential. 18 This school will serve only as a magnet school for the arts, and not as a magnet 19 school for mathematics nor the sciences. There shall be no duplication of programs 20 already offered by the Jimmy D. Long, Sr. Louisiana School for Math, Science, and 21 the Arts in Natchitoches. Beyond a demonstration of minimum competencies 22 expected of all equivalent high school students in Louisiana, admission criteria at the 23 Louis Armstrong High School for the Arts shall not be based upon competitive 24 academic testing, but exclusively upon auditions, or submission of creative writing 25 and art. 26 * * * 27 §1970.3.
